Former Man United boss Sir Alex Ferguson has warned incoming Man City manager Pep Guardiola not to expect Barcelona-like success with the Citizens. Although SAF admitted that Pep could be successful at Man City, he mentioned that this will the toughest test for the Spaniard after leaving Bundesliga giants Bayern Munich at the end of the season.

The Spanish tactician is set to replace Manuel Pellegrini at the Etihad Stadium this summer, something that has already sparked great expectations among fans of the English giants. In his reign at Barcelona, Pep won 3 consecutive La Liga titles, 2 Champions Leagues, 2 Copa del Reys, and 2 FIFA Club World Cups. 

WATCH: Xabi Alonso shares his thoughts on Pep Guardiola's influence at Bayern Munich:

In Germany, the experienced tactician is eyeing his third consecutive Bundesliga title with The Bavarians and a Champions League title this season. Speaking during an interview with Sky Sports News, SAF explained that the level of the competition in the Premier League will be an eye-opener for the incoming City boss.

He said:

“Pep has got a fantastic work ethic about him, and he demands that from all his training sessions. So anyone who says they're not going to work hard won't last long I'm sure of that.

“He has got great coaching ability there's no doubt about that. It's interesting because it'll be difficult to match what he did at Barcelona.’’

"Obviously Man City have had a real coup in getting him because he's an outstanding coach, but Pep won't find it easy. English football is not easy. Every foreign coach who has come to England will tell you that.

He added:

“Arsene Wenger, after a few months [of arriving], he was talking about that. Even Jose we he came, after his first season he realised what he achieved was hard work.

"So, he will be a success I don't think he'll ever replicate what he ever did at Barcelona but that was a high standard. They were the best.”

The Scottish manager won 13 Premier League titles with Man United, 5 FA Cups, 4 League Cups, 10 Community Shields, 2 Champions Leagues, 1 UEFA Super Cup, 1 Intercontinental Cup and 1 FIFA Club World Cup in 27 years at Old Trafford.
